Here's how experienced each driver will be ahead of 2012
Races:
0 – Charles Pic, Jean Eric Vergne
7 – Romain Grosjean
11 – Daniel Ricciardo
17 – Sergio Perez
19 – Nico Hulkenberg
19 – Paul di Resta
19 – Pastor Maldonado
40 – Kamui Kobayashi
72 – Timo Glock
81 – Sebastian Vettel
86 – Pedro de La Rosa
89 – Heikki Kovalainen
90 – Lewis Hamilton
108 – Nico Rosberg
152 – Felipe Massa
156 – Kimi Raikkonen
176 – Mark Webber
177 – Fernando Alonso
208 – Jenson Button
252 – Jarno Trulli
287 – Michael Schumacher
